> I am working in Angola and have had a lot of problems with electricity // 
> until I have discovered this soft.
> It works perfectly with the apc network card (It came as an option on my APC 
> 1500).
>
> I have setup apcupsd to use snmp (this seems to be the most stable use).
>
>
> I was very surprised because the soft did shutdown the server automatically 
> when the UPS went out of battery? and I had not tested that (lack of time).
> So the soft even went beyond my expectations?
>

it is important too to make sure BIOS settings are set to automatically 
power up computer when power is present.

by default it will not until you press a button
